1-Channel Speech Synthesizer

The NY3 series are single-chip voice synthesizing CMOS IC. According to different IC series, each body has one to five I/O pins. Through accurate internal oscillation, external Rosc is unnecessary. There is only one PWM output for voice. Thus any external component is not required. Customer’s speech data can be programmed into ROM by changing one code mask during fabrication. Besides, two interactive software developing tools of “Q-Speech” & “Quick-IO” are user-friendly and quick for programming.

Feature:

  • Wide operating voltage: 1.6V ~ 6.4V.
  • Total maximum 1536 Voice Steps are available for 128 Voice Sentences.
  • One 9-bit / 10-bit PWM output. There are 2 kinds of PWM output, normal and large. It can directly drive 8, 16, 32, 64Ω speaker or piezo-buzzer.
  • Low-Voltage-Reset (LVR) option. When voltage is lower than 1.5V, IC will reset by itself. (Mask Option)
  • Only build in an accurate internal oscillator, no external R oscillator. There are many kinds of options for play speed, and each Step can select any one of them independently.
  • Two interactive software developing tools of “Q-Speech” & “Quick-IO” are user-friendly and quick for programming, then users can write BIN code into OTP very fast by “Q-Writer“ software cooperating with “OTP_Writer“ hardware.
